Transaction 3476bbd699a63e9d023f7928b441de4c686121669d7d624149540750814ea369
1 Input
1 Output
-
3476bbd699a63e9d023f7928b441de4c686121669d7d624149540750814ea369:0
- value
- 42458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c8996d807643da0386fe2084e3276a8361be625 OP_EQUAL
- address
- 3EW7MGUNqNHZy8RLyD85udCu5JuiEEXRbW